## Step 4: Shard Cutover (Profile Store)

Once the Harrowgate profile shards report healthy, flip the router flag `shard_mode=ranged` and drain the legacy node. The cutover job writes a signed checkpoint to each shard before traffic shifts. Sign the checkpoint manifest with the key below:

rollout seal: bky6_osViJn

Quarterly Planning Note — Eastmarch Expansion

Sales leads: good news — the push into the Eastmarch region is officially on for next quarter. We'll start with two field reps and a partner-led channel, leaning on the Solara product bundle as the opener. Expect territory maps and target lists by end of month; quotas stay unchanged until the region proves out. There's one confidential piece of the plan worth knowing, noted below.

internal memo for hahaf-yahap: Gross margin on Zorwyn came in at 15 percent against a plan of 20 percent. Only 7 of the 80 pilot accounts renewed Zorwyn, so a churn review is set for January 15.

Leadership Review Briefing — Warranty Costs

Quick one for branch managers ahead of the review: warranty spend on the Kestrel pump line at Mowbray Equipment ran about 30% over plan this quarter. Most claims trace to a seal batch from the Ardenfield run, now quarantined. Field fixes are underway and costs should normalize by next quarter. Expect questions, so skim the claim summary beforehand. How this shapes our plans is noted confidentially below.

board note of kageg-bahof: The renewal with Holwynax Holdings closes at $2 million a year, 5 percent below the last contract. Project Ulaath slips by two quarters because of the supplier delay.

**Ticket: Config drift in Oxbow ORM refactor**

While refactoring the legacy Oxbow ORM layer, we found staging and prod disagree on connection pooling and lazy-load flags, which masked two N+1 regressions during review. Please verify the refactor branch against the canonical values, not whatever your local env has. The canonical settings follow below.

service settings:
PRAIX_LOG_LEVEL=error
PRAIX_METRICS_HOST=metrics.praix.qorvelcorp.corp
PRAIX_POOL_SIZE=16